Darlington County School District announces new personnel assignments
Following the departure of former Darlington High School (DHS) Principal Dr. Greg Harrison for another professional opportunity, the district has named DHS Lead Assistant Principal Cortney Gehrke as the school’s interim principal. Gehrke began working for the DCSD in 2005 as an English teacher at Lamar High School. She also taught and worked as an administrator at Spaulding Middle School and Hartsville Middle School. Governor’s School instructor releases book of poetry
Dr. Adam Houle wants to teach his students to find ways to say something significant. Earlier this year, Houle himself reached an important milestone with his writing when his book, Stray, was released by Lithic Press.
ScienceSouth brings the stars, constellations alive inside the A.W. Stanley Gym
The stars came out to play last Tuesday when ScienceSouth made a visit to the A.W. Stanley Gym. The event, sponsored by the Macedonia Life-Skills Center, featured several virtual shows as well as activities for the children.
Hartsville Recycler of the Month – June 2017
John Byrd has been named the City of Hartsville’s Recycler of the Month for June 2017. As the Recycler of the Month, he received a yard sign as well as a Main Street Hartsville downtown gift certificate. The award program highlights those city residents participating in the City of Hartsville’s recycling program, a partnership between the city and Sonoco.
